- (ar lean ón leathanach roimhe)At that time there were food stations set up. One of those stations was in the house where Joe Salmon now resides. It consisted of a large boiler of Indian meal stirabout. This was dealt out in measures pints, or quarts, according to the families number, and before one became qualified for this your house was searched to see if there were oat meal concealed or any other. The population was three times as big as it is to day. I am told there was upwards of sixty families in Balldavid alone. Then through the famine came sickness and the work house what we call the county home to day.
